    Case Summary: In WPA/307/2026, petitioner Smti. V. Radha challenged the Andaman and Nicobar Administration. On June 18, 2026, the High Court Circuit Bench at Port Blair found that no one appeared for the petitioner and no accommodation was requested. The court adjourned the matter, ordering it to be listed before the next Circuit Bench for further hearing.
